财务管理系统数据字典
时间: 2023-12-02 07:41:50 浏览: 447
财务管理系统数据字典是指对系统中使用到的各种数据进行定义和说明的文档,包括数据的名称、数据类型、数据长度、数据来源、数据用途等信息。数据字典的作用是方便系统管理员和开发人员对系统中的数据进行管理和维护,同时也方便用户对系统中的数据进行理解和使用。
在本家庭理财管理系统中,数据字典管理功能可以帮助管理员对系统中使用到的各种数据进行管理和维护。管理员可以通过数据字典管理功能添加、修改、删除数据字典中的数据项,同时也可以查看数据字典中的各种数据项的详细信息,包括数据类型、数据长度、数据来源、数据用途等信息。这些信息可以帮助管理员更好地理解和使用系统中的各种数据。
以下是一个简单的财务管理系统数据字典的例子:
| 数据项名称 | 数据类型 | 数据长度 | 数据来源 | 数据用途 |
| --- | --- | --- | --- | --- |
| 用户名 | 字符串 | 20 | 用户注册 | 用户登录 |
| 密码 | 字符串 | 20 | 用户注册 | 用户登录 |
| 角色 | 字符串 | 10 | 管理员设置 | 用户权限控制 |
| 收入金额 | 浮点数 | 10 | 用户输入 | 收入记录 |
| 支出金额 | 浮点数 | 10 | 用户输入 | 支出记录 |
| 收入类型 | 字符串 | 10 | 管理员设置 | 收入记录分类 |
| 支出类型 | 字符串 | 10 | 管理员设置 | 支出记录分类 |
相关问题
旅行社信息管理系统数据字典
以下是旅行社信息管理系统的数据字典:
1.出境游信息表(travel_abroad):记录出境游的相关信息,包括出境游编号、出境游名称、出境游目的地、出境游天数、出境游价格等字段。
2.国内游信息表(travel_domestic):记录国内游的相关信息,包括国内游编号、国内游名称、国内游目的地、国内游天数、国内游价格等字段。
3.港澳游信息表(travel_hk_mo):记录港澳游的相关信息,包括港澳游编号、港澳游名称、港澳游目的地、港澳游天数、港澳游价格等字段。
4.入境游信息表(travel_inbound):记录入境游的相关信息,包括入境游编号、入境游名称、入境游目的地、入境游天数、入境游价格等字段。
5.国内地接信息表(travel_local):记录国内地接的相关信息,包括国内地接编号、国内地接名称、国内地接目的地、国内地接天数、国内地接价格等字段。
6.省内短线信息表(travel_short):记录省内短线的相关信息,包括省内短线编号、省内短线名称、省内短线目的地、省内短线天数、省内短线价格等字段。
7.单项委托业务信息表(travel_single):记录单项委托业务的相关信息,包括单项委托业务编号、单项委托业务名称、单项委托业务目的地、单项委托业务天数、单项委托业务价格等字段。
8.计调信息表(travel_arrange):记录计调的相关信息,包括计调编号、计调名称、计调内容、计调人员、计调时间等字段。
9.前台门市销售信息表(sales_front):记录前台门市销售的相关信息,包括销售编号、销售人员、销售时间、销售产品、销售数量、销售金额等字段。
10.商务中心信息表(business_center):记录商务中心的相关信息,包括商务中心编号、商务中心名称、商务中心地址、商务中心联系人、商务中心联系电话等字段。
11.财务结算信息表(finance_settlement):记录财务结算的相关信息,包括结算编号、结算时间、结算人员、结算金额等字段。
12.客户关系管理信息表(customer_relationship):记录客户关系管理的相关信息,包括客户编号、客户姓名、客户性别、客户联系电话、客户邮箱等字段。
13.网络营销信息表(network_marketing):记录网络营销的相关信息,包括营销编号、营销名称、营销内容、营销人员、营销时间等字段。
如何利用数据流图和数据字典来设计一个高效的工资管理系统?请结合《工资管理系统数据字典解析 - 软件工程实践》给出答案。
设计一个高效的工资管理系统,关键在于对系统内部的数据流动和存储有清晰的认识,这正是数据流图(DFD)和数据字典发挥作用的地方。《工资管理系统数据字典解析 - 软件工程实践》这本书深入讲解了如何在工资管理系统的开发过程中应用这两种工具,下面是如何结合该资料进行设计的详细步骤:
参考资源链接:[工资管理系统数据字典解析 - 软件工程实践](https://wenku.csdn.net/doc/5eumypbckx?spm=1055.2569.3001.10343)
1. **需求收集与分析阶段**:首先,需要通过和人事部门、财务部门以及员工的沟通,收集对工资管理的需求。在这一阶段,数据字典开始发挥作用,它记录了收集到的每个数据元素,包括名称、类型、来源以及每个数据元素的含义。
2. **数据流图绘制**:根据需求分析的结果,绘制出系统的数据流图。数据流图需要展示数据从外部实体(如人事处、员工所在工作部门和财务处)流动到系统,再从系统输出到外部实体(如工资报表)的过程。数据流图帮助开发者理解工资管理系统中数据的流动方向和处理逻辑。
3. **数据字典的详细定义**:在数据流图的基础上,对所有涉及到的数据元素进行详细的定义。例如,对于人事处输入的职工档案工资数据,需要定义具体的字段和数据类型,如员工ID是字符型,基础工资是浮点型。此外,还需要明确每个数据元素的使用场景和约束。
4. **数据字典与数据流图的交互验证**:确保数据流图中每一个数据流都在数据字典中有对应的定义,并且数据字典中的每个元素都能在数据流图中找到流向。这一步骤是保证数据完整性和系统设计一致性的重要环节。
5. **系统设计与实现**:根据数据流图和数据字典中的信息,进行系统的详细设计。这包括数据库设计、模块划分、接口设计等。数据字典中的定义是数据库设计的基础,确保数据库中的数据结构与需求一致。
6. **测试与评估**:系统实现后,需要根据数据字典中定义的数据元素和数据流图中描述的数据流动过程进行测试。测试包括单元测试、集成测试、系统测试等,确保系统满足性能指标,并且所有数据处理正确无误。
通过上述步骤,结合《工资管理系统数据字典解析 - 软件工程实践》提供的理论和实践指导,可以设计出一个既符合实际需求又高效可靠的工资管理系统。
在掌握了设计流程后,如果想进一步深入了解软件工程的其他方面,如性能指标分析、软件分类、系统文档编写等,推荐继续参阅《工资管理系统数据字典解析 - 软件工程实践》。该资料将提供深入的理论背景和案例分析,为你的系统设计工作提供全面的参考。
参考资源链接:[工资管理系统数据字典解析 - 软件工程实践](https://wenku.csdn.net/doc/5eumypbckx?spm=1055.2569.3001.10343)
阅读全文